    I'm having a problem with the remote control feature... it won't update any variable value or turn any output on or off, it just shows the start up variable values, port is set to 4242 and i mapped it...

    Quote Originally Posted by alejoal07 View Post
    I'm having a problem with the remote control feature... it won't update any variable value or turn any output on or off, it just shows the start up variable values, port is set to 4242 and i mapped it...
    and you made sure to change the user name to something in the configuration file and register that name online?

    Do you have MDX blocked with your firewall? And do you have port 4242 opened and forwarded to your computer?
